Gluten-Free Honey Sesame Chicken Bites

  • Total Time: 23 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ings

Description

These Gluten-Free Honey Sesame Chicken Bites are a quick and flavorful main dish made with tender chicken breast, natural honey, sesame seeds, and aromatic seasonings. They caramelize beautifully in the skillet for a sweet, savory glaze that’s perfect for any mealtime.


Ingredients

2 lbs chicken breast, cut into bite-sized pieces

5 tablespoons honey, divided

2 tablespoons sesame seeds, divided

1 teaspoon ground ginger

½ teaspoon salt

½ teaspoon pepper

1 teaspoon garlic powder

½ teaspoon onion powder

1 tablespoon olive oil


Instructions

1. Add 1 tablespoon of olive oil to a large skillet or frying pan and heat over medium heat.

2. Add the bite-sized chicken breast, 3 tablespoons honey, 1 tablespoon sesame seeds, ground ginger, salt, pepper, garlic powder, and onion powder.

3. Mix everything together until well combined.

4. Let the chicken sit for 5–7 minutes before stirring. Mix again and let it sit another 5–7 minutes, until the chicken is no longer pink and cooked through.

5. Increase the heat to medium-high, then add the remaining 2 tablespoons honey and 1 tablespoon sesame seeds.

6. Cook until the chicken caramelizes, about 1½ minutes without stirring, then 2½ minutes stirring often.

7. Sprinkle extra sesame seeds before serving for a glossy finish.

Notes

Instead of honey, you can use maple syrup for a different flavor.

Fresh ginger can be used instead of ground ginger for a bolder taste.

Serve with steamed vegetables or jasmine rice for a complete meal.
